Miscreants rob 50k from Jamtara petrol pump

  • | Monday | 16th October, 2023

Dumka: Three motorcyle-borne unidentified miscreants struck a petrol pump at Kalajhariya located on the Jamtara-Karmatand Road on Saturday evening and decamped with around Rs 50,000 after taking the owner and the employees hostage on gun point, police said.Jamtara sub-divisional police officer (SDPO) Anand Jyoti Minj said, The three accused arrived at the petrol pump at about 7:30pm on Saturday on a motorcycle as customers. They pointed country-made pistols at the employees when the latter demanded money for the petrol filled in the bike. They took pump owner Lalmohan Singh hostage on gun point and looted Rs 50,000 from the cash box, before fleeing. The robbers also snatched the mobile phones of the hostages but threw these at some distance from the site while escaping, he added.Police said one of the robbers was wearing a helmet while the remaining two had covered their faces with clothes. The incident was captured in the CCTV cameras.
